T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
PROTOCOL/STANDARDS
• HomePlug 1.0 specification, IEEE 802.3 10 Base-T Ethernet
(10Mbps) compliant
• 10Mbps AutoMDI/MDIx Support
• 14 Mbps HomePlug 1.0 compatible
• CSMA/CA MAC Control
MODULATION SUPPORT
• OFDM, DQPSK, DBPSK, ROBO Carrier Modulation Support
FREQUENCY BAND
• 4.3MHz ~ 20.9MHz
QUALITY OF SERVICE
• Forward Error Correction (FEC) support
• Channel Adaptation ensures that signal integrity is
maintained even under harsh noise environment
• CSMA/CA with prioritisation and Automatic Repeat Request
(ARQ) for reliable delivery of Ethernet packets via Packet
Encapsulation
• Four Level prioritised random access method
• Segment bursting and contention-free access ensures high
throughput while maintaining low latency response and jitter
performance
SECURITY SUPPORT
• 56-bit DES Encryption with key management for secure
powerline communications (Use Windows platform to
enable encryption)
PLATFORM SUPPORT
• Windows 98SE, Me, 2000 or XP
POWER SUPPLY
• Integrated 240V AC Supply via power socket
LED INDICATORS
• 1x Power LED
• 1x Powerline Link Status LED
• 1x Ethernet Link/Activity Status LED
EXTERNAL CONNECTORS
• 1x Electrical Power Socket
• 1x RJ45 for 10 Base-T Ethernet (Auto MDI/MDIx)
APPROVALS
• C-Tick
• Energy Authority Approval - Q050207
MINIMUM SYSTEM REQUIREMENTS:
• Windows Operating Systems: Microsoft Windows (98se, Me,
2000 or XP PC system) with Ethernet connection, Pentium II
300 MHz MMX-Compatible PC or greater, minimum 64MB
hard disk space and memory, CD-ROM drive
• Maximum of 15 devices connected to power line network
• All HomePlugs must be on the same power circuit
PACKAGE CONTENTS
• 2 x NP210 HomePlug Adaptors
• 2 x RJ45 10/100 Ethernet cables
• 1 x Configuration/Manual CD
• 1 x Quick Start Guide

Instant networking with NetComm’s NP210 HomePlug
HomePlug transforms your in-house power circuit into an
Instant Ethernet Network without the need to install new
cables or drill holes through walls and floors. You can
connect up to 15 devices to your HomePlug “network”,
including PCs, laptops, gaming consoles and ADSL
Modem/Routers. With a data carrier rate of 14Mbps
and a range of 200 metres, HomePlug is an ideal way
to extend your network access to any room or any floor
in your home or office. HomePlug is also secure using
its DESpro encryption to keep your data secure from
eavesdroppers.
